ANNETTE (KLEPPER) HINRICHSEN

Annette (Klepper) Hinrichsen was born on May 8, 1953 to Kenneth and Bonita Klepper in Pawnee City, Nebraska. Annette passed away on August 3, 1994 at Bryan Memorial Hospital in Lincoln, Nebraska.

Annette attended grade school and high school in Pawnee City and graduated in 1971. She then attended two years of college at Tarkio, Missouri.

Annette was married to Jack L. Hinrichsen on March 10, 1973. To this union were born, Vaughn, Natalie and Stewart, all living at home on their farm south of Pawnee City.

Annette accepted Christ as her personal Savior on March 24, 1963 at the age of ten and continued to grow spiritually from that day on in serving the Lord. She was active in AWANA, a children's ministry and a co-sponsor of FCA.

Her greatest joy was when her husband and three children each individually accepted Christ as their personal Savior, and they grew together serving the Lord as a family.

Annette was a loving, devoted wife and mother and her family always knew that they could count on her for support. Annette was blessed with many talents and shared them with everyone. She had a beautiful voice which she used for the Lord in singing at church, for weddings and funerals. Her home showed her creativity and ability to decorate. She loved nature and all kinds of flowers which she planted around her home.

Annette was preceded in death by her mother; grandparents Glenn and Almeda Stewart, Herbert and Helen Klepper; nephew Lucas Klepper.

She is survived by her husband, Jack, children Vaughn, Natalie and Stewart; father, Kenneth Klepper; sisters Jenett Reed and Kenny of Pawnee City, Beverly Crews and Thomas of Annona, Texas; Becki Smith and Bob of Pawnee City, Cathy Schafer and Terry of DuBois. Brothers Kenny,Jr. and Louis Klepper of Severy, Kansas, Herb and Yvonne Klepper of Pawnee City, Richard and Sandy Klepper of Osceola, Jon and Cheryth Klepper of DuBois, Keith and Joyce Klepper of Glendale, Arizona, Mike and Linda Klepper of Sabetha; nieces, nephews and numerous friends and relatives.

(Pawnee Republican, Aug. 1994)
